Bullosis diabeticorum is a spontaneous, non-inflammatory, blistering condition seen in patients with diabetes mellitus that can be diagnosed after excluding similar conditions. The lesions described in bullosis diabeticorum have been reported to typically resolve without any specific treatment or scarring and are often considered to be self-limiting.We report a case of a 49-year-old man with type 1 diabetes who presented with recurrent episodes of bullosis diabeticorum, complicated by infection and ultimately resulting in bilateral major amputations.This case highlights the fact that bullosis diabeticorum may not follow an uncomplicated self-limiting course and also the need for early recognition and prompt treatment of infection. Atraumatic splenic rupture is a rare complication of a pancreatic pseudocyst (PP), described in the setting of chronic pancreatitis. There is common understanding, within the literature, that an inflammatory process at the tail of the pancreas may disrupt the spleen and result in such splenic complications. The authors present a case report of a 29-year-old male with a PP, associated with chronic pancreatitis. The patient had a history of excessive alcohol intake and presented to the emergency department with a short history of abdominal pain and vomiting. He denied any significant history of trauma and serum amylase levels were normal. An admission computed tomography (CT) scan of the abdomen confirmed the presence of a PP in direct contact with the spleen. The CT also demonstrated a heterogenous hypodense area of the splenic hilum, along with perisplenic fluid. The patient was admitted for observation. His abdominal pain progressed, and he became haemodynamically unstable. An emergency ultrasound scan (USS) at this time revealed intra-abdominal haemorrhage. A subsequent CT confirmed splenic rupture, which was managed surgically with a full recovery. Few such cases are documented within the literature and more understanding of preempting such events is needed.
Background The Apnoea–Hypopnoea index (AHI) is regarded as a gold standard diagnostic marker of Obstructive Sleep Apnoea Syndrome (OSAS). However, a number of patients present with excessive daytime sleepiness (EDS), yet exhibit a raised Respiratory Disturbance Index (RDI), comprising of flow limited breaths in the presence of a normal AHI (<5 events/hr). We sought to evaluate the benefits of CPAP in this “Flow Limitation” cohort compared to a matched population of OSAS subjects. Results 27 subjects (Mean age 47 (SD 8) years; ESS 17(4); 48% male; BMI 35.60 (8.12)) presented to our Sleep Service with EDS and undertook a cardio-respiratory polysomnograph, demonstrating an RDI >15 and AHI <5 (Mean RDI 16 (4); AHI 3(2); ODI 5(3)) 25 subjects were subsequently treated with CPAP. At “6-week compliance” visits, 20 (80%) were deemed compliant with CPAP (mean nightly usage 6.03 (1.47) hrs; pre-CPAP ESS 18(3) falling to 9 (4) following CPAP. Within the Flow Limitation cohort, statistically significant associations were observed between CPAP compliance and Female gender (100 v 55%), higher BMI (36.61 v 31.56), higher pre-CPAP ESS (18 v13) and lower Pulse Transit Time PTT (300.90 v 316 ms). This “Flow Limitation” cohort was compared with an age/gender matched “OSAS “cohort (ESS 15(5); BMI 38.33 (7.80) AHI 58.16 (25.79) ODI 48 (23)). 26 OSAS subjects were treated with CPAP with 19 (70%) deemed compliant (nightly usage 5.25 (3.55) hrs; pre-CPAP ESS 16 (5) falling to 10(5) following CPAP. Whilst the mean PTT of the OSAS cohort was lower than the “Flow Limitation” cohort, this did not reach statistical significance (298.85(15.04) v 306.44 (18.36) ms; ANOVA; p = 0.1) yet the PTT Deceleration Index (DI), a surrogate of physiological arousal, was significantly higher in the OSAS cohort (59.05(29.33) v 36.32(23.69)/hour; ANOVA; p = 0.003). Conclusion “Sleepy” subjects exhibiting an elevated Flow Limitation Index in the presence of a normal AHI appear to demonstrate a response to CPAP therapy comparable to that observed in OSAS. Female gender and a higher BMI appear to predict compliance with therapy, whilst the utility of Pulse Transit Time in guiding decision making in “sleepy” subjects with a normal AHI merits further study.

The Ehrenfest Urn Model (P. and T. Ehrenfest (1907)) has had application to heat exchange problems between two isolated bodies. The basic model can be described as an urn containing w/sub 0/ white and b/sub 0/ black balls. A ball is drawn at random from the urn and is replaced by a ball of opposite color. The interest is in the distribution of W/sub n/, the number of white balls in the urn after n drawings with replacement. A number of modifications and generalizations of the model are knwon. A further generalization of the model is given which permits replacement by a ball of either color with randomization before each replacement.
